feat(chat): stored-transcript QA service (ADR-027)
A read-only deeper-dive over a video's already-stored transcript (ADR-021). Safe by construction: the Service has no VideoSource and no caption-fetch dependency — only a Completer factory over the existing LiteLLM gateway — so it cannot reach YouTube or the rate gate. Reuses the summarizer's truncation discipline (TAPIR_MAX_TRANSCRIPT_CHARS), reporting the cut so the UI can be honest about a bounded transcript. Model defaults to the summary's model and is switchable among an offered, local-first list; an un-offered alias is forced back to the default so chat can never call the gateway with an arbitrary model. // truncate caps content to max bytes on a UTF-8 rune boundary, reporting whether
|
||||
// it cut. It mirrors the summarizer's truncation discipline (ADR-022) but returns
|
||||
// the cut flag so the chat UI can be honest about a bounded transcript. A
|
||||
// non-positive max (or content already within budget) returns content unchanged.
|
||||
func truncate(content string, max int) (string, bool) {
|
||||
if max <= 0 || len(content) <= max {
|
||||
return content, false
|
||||
}
|
||||
cut := max
|
||||
for cut > 0 && !utf8.RuneStart(content[cut]) {
|
||||
cut--
|
||||
}
|
||||
return content[:cut], true
|
||||
}
